300字范文,内容丰富有趣,生活中的好帮手!
300字范文 > 如何彻底删除MySQL中的数据 避免数据泄露风险? mysqli查询返回数组

如何彻底删除MySQL中的数据 避免数据泄露风险? mysqli查询返回数组

时间:2022-10-29 17:09:20

相关推荐

如何彻底删除MySQL中的数据 避免数据泄露风险? mysqli查询返回数组

ysqldump命令,也可以使用其他第三方备份工具。

2. 使用DELETE命令删除数据

在MySQL中,可以使用DELETE命令删除数据。但是,这种删除方式只是将数据标记为已删除,而并没有真正删除数据。这样会导致数据仍然存在于数据库中,占用空间,同时也存在数据泄露的风险。

3. 使用TRUNCATE命令删除数据

TRUNCATE命令可以快速删除表中的所有数据,与DELETE命令不同的是,TRUNCATE命令删除数据时不会将数据标记为已删除,而是直接删除数据,释放空间。但是,TRUNCATE命令只能删除整张表的数据,不能删除部分数据。

4. 使用DROP命令删除表

DROP命令可以删除整张表,包括表结构和数据。使用DROP命令需要谨慎,因为一旦删除,数据将无法恢复。在使用DROP命令删除表之前,应该先备份数据。

5. 使用外键约束删除数据

在MySQL中,可以使用外键约束来删除数据。外键约束可以保证数据的完整性,同时也可以避免数据泄露的风险。在删除数据时,应该先删除与之相关的数据,然后再删除本身数据。

总结:彻底删除MySQL中的数据需要谨慎对待,应该先备份数据,选择合适的删除方式,同时也应该遵循数据完整性和安全原则。

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。